Đồng bộ hóa dữ liệu giữa iPhone và máy tính cài Ubuntu

00:00, 07/07/2010

Trong Mac và Windows, bạn có thể dễ dàng đồng bộ hoá iPhone/iPod Touch thông qua tiện ích iTunes, nhưng trong Linux, không có cách nào dễ dàng để đồng bộ thư viện nhạc iDevice của bạn với bất kỳ tiện ích media nào khác. Thậm chí nếu bạn muốn tiến hành jailbreak cho iPhone trên Ubunu thì bạn sẽ phải trải qua nhiều bước phức tạp. Tuy nhiên, với sự ra đời của tiện ích miễn phí iFuse (và các gói thư viện khác) thì mọi thứ đã thay đổi. Bạn không chỉ có thể mount  chiếc iPhone của bạn như là một ổ đĩa gắn ngoài trong Ubuntu mà bạn cũng có thể sử dụng nó để đồng bộ thư viện nhạc của bạn với Rhythmbox. Bạn có thể tải tiện ích iFuse mới nhất từ địa chỉ http://www.libimobiledevice.org
Sau đây là các hướng dẫn để đồng bộ hóa iPhone (firmware 3.0) với máy tính cài hệ điều hành Ubuntu Karmic.

1/ Gỡ bỏ các phiên bản iFuse cũ

Bạn có thể bỏ qua bước này nếu bạn chưa từng cài bất kỳ phiên bản iFuse nào vào máy tính. Từ giao diện chình của Ubuntu, bạn vào menu Applications>Accessories rồi bấm chuột vào biểu tượng Terminal để mở cửa sổ Terminal.
Từ cửa sổ Terminal, bạn nhập vào các câu lệnh sau (nhấn Enter sau mỗi câu lệnh) :
sudo apt-get remove gvfs-backends ifuse limobiledevice-dev libplist0 libplist-dev libiphone0 libiphone0-dev limobiledevice0 libgpod4 libusbmux0 libusbmux-dev gtkpod gtkpod-common

sudo gedit /etc/apt/sources.list

Sau cùng, nhấp thêm câu lệnh sau để refresh lại hệ thống
 
sudo apt-get update && sudo apt-get upgrade

2/ Cài đặt iFuse lên máy tính

Để tải gói iFuse PPA từ internet về máy tính, từ cửa sổ Terminal, bạn nhập dòng lệnh sau rồi nhấn Enter để xác nhận :
 sudo add-apt-repository ppa:pmcenery/ppa

Gõ tiếp dòng lệnh sau để cập nhật lại hệ thống, bạn cũng nên tiến hành khởi động lại máy tính sau khi thực hiện xong lệnh này.

sudo apt-get update && sudo apt-get dist-upgrade


Tiếp tục, gõ lệnh sau để cài đặt các gói ứng dụng có liên quan đến iFuse

sudo apt-get install gvfs gvfs-backends gvfs-bin gvfs-fuse libgvfscommon0 ifuse libgpod-dev libgpod-common libimobiledevice-utils libimobiledevice0 libimobiledevice-dev libplist++1 libplist-utils python-plist libusb-1.0-0 libusb-1.0-0-dev libusbmuxd1 usbmuxd

 
Sau khi cài đặt xong iFuse, bạn bấm chuột vào menu System sau đó chọn Users and Groups. Một cửa sổ có tên là User Settings hiện ra, tại đây bạn nhấn chuột vào biểu tượng hình chìa khóa để “mở khóa”, tiếp tục nhấn nút Manage Groups rồi tìm đến mục fuse từ danh sách vừa hiện ra sau đó nhấn nút Properties.
 Từ cửa sổ Group fuse Properties, bạn đánh dấu chọn vào ô trống phía trước tên người dùng mà bạn muốn cho phép thực thi ứng dụng iFuse. Sau cùng, nhấn OK để xác nhận.
Vậy là xong, công việc còn lại của bạn là khởi động lại máy tính rồi tiến hành kết nối iPhone vào máy tính để đồng bộ hóa nó thông qua Rhythmbox.

     Võ Xuân Vỹ (Theo MakeTechEasier.com)